It is with deep sadness that we announce the passing of Joshua Hennion at the age of 51.
Josh was born in Burlington County, New Jersey on July 2, 1973, to Alexander and Stephanie Hennion. Though born on the East Coast, his early years were shaped by a family journey westward—driven by his father’s dreams and ambitions—which eventually brought them to Simi Valley, California, the place Josh would call home for most of his life.
Josh was a devoted brother, a cherished colleague, and a quiet force of reliability and heart. After the tragic loss of his father and older brother Adam in a motorcycle accident when he was just six years old, Josh remained resilient and deeply connected to his family, especially his twin brother Jason, with whom he shared an unbreakable bond.
Professionally, Josh worked as the Computer Department Lead for Production Resource Group Inc. LLC. In this role, he ensured the computers used for major events were meticulously tested and prepared. He was a key figure in coordinating with the operations team, ensuring all gear was accounted for and event-ready. His dedication to precision and reliability was respected by all who worked with him.
Beyond work, Josh had a passion for film and television. He was a devoted fan of Star Wars, the Marvel universe, and countless other cinematic worlds. His love of storytelling was matched by his enthusiasm for food—both watching the Food Network and experimenting in the kitchen with recipes and flavor combinations that caught his curiosity.
Josh is preceded in death by his parents, Alexander and Stephanie Hennion; his older brother, Adam Hennion; his step-sister, and Tami Hennion. He is survived by his brother, Jason Hennion, with whom he shared a life of memories, support, and companionship.
Josh will be remembered for his quiet strength, his deep loyalty, his sense of wonder, and his kind heart. His absence leaves a profound silence, but his memory will live on in the hearts of those who loved and knew him well.
